Your role

 

We are seeking a National Sector Lead – Municipal to support and implement a robust strategy for growth. As an established leader in this sector, you will be responsible for identifying relevant trends and opportunities for

Colliers' growth in them.

 

You will successfully operate in a matrix organizational structure to develop, direct, and lead in the execution of the sector strategy to achieve desired growth targets.

 

You will provide sector leadership by bolstering our brand identity, authoring thought leadership, and speaking at conferences.

 

You have an established and growing network of relationships with key organizations and clients throughout the Municipal Sector nationally.

Responsibilities

  • Building a strong presence across Canada in municipal capital project delivery and advisory services
  • Keeping abreast of trends and challenges relevant to the sector and Colliers Project Leaders
  • Identify opportunities, key accounts and clients nationally and in collaboration with business leaders develop a plan to grow the sales pipeline
  • Support Business Units on priority pursuits with capture strategy, sector specific input, guidance on relevant trends, challenges, and commercial strategy
  • Develop and own the sector strategy in support of the corporate strategy this includes development and execution of multi-year road maps
  • Lead and direct the development of the sector sales plan, with input from key stakeholders, to achieve the sector sales targets for the year.
  • In collaboration with other business leaders, identify the required expertise and capacity to win and deliver projects in the sector nationally
  • People leader for the Municipal sector team
  • Collaborative behavior with colleagues, other business leaders and external partners with a strong orientation towards business growth.
  • Clarify and anticipate sector trends and articulate how they affect clients in the sector, both internally and externally, developing approaches to address them.
  • Establish a strong brand presence for Colliers Project Leaders in the sector through authoring thought leadership, featuring in video spotlights, speaking at events and conferences nationally, and in existing sector accounts.
  • Identify regional and national participants for sector related conferences and events.
  • Acquire membership and actively participate in sector organizations, pursuing leadership positions where appropriate, that will help grow the business, increase sector, and market identity, and recruit the best talent.

Qualifications

  • A minimum of ten (10) years’ experience as a leader (consultant or owner side) in municipal capital delivery and/or municipal services
  • Minimum five (5) years’ experience in leading sales strategy and/or business growth
  • Clear understanding of a professional services business model, including resource management strategies, risk management strategies, and commercial strategies
  • Professional industry credentials relevant and specific to the sector are a strong asset.
  • Known industry player and leader across the sector nationally and well connected with key organizations and clients (target and existing) in the sector.
  • An established network of sector contacts nationally and involvement with applicable sector industry and trade associations.
  • Excellent verbal and written communication, facilitation, and presentation skills for all levels of our clients and our own organization
  • Effective leadership and organizational skills with the ability to successfully lead teams and company-wide initiatives
  • Willingness to travel as required across Canada.
